C# 死锁 TaskCompletionSource

异步转同步时,使用不当容易造成死锁(程序卡死)

看如下案例:

有一个异步方法

1 private static async Task TestAsync() 2 { 3 Debug.WriteLine("异步任务start……"); 4 await Task.Delay(2000); 5 Debug.WriteLine("异步任务end……"); 6 }

内容版权声明:除非注明,否则皆为本站原创文章。

转载注明出处:https://www.heiqu.com/zwyxyy.html